Is it possible to download a snapshot of PH, for off-line use at a later date?

What I mean, for example, is that when I'm travelling it would be great if I could have on my laptop a downloaded file of PH at that time. Then I could surf and browse through it (although it won't be updated) while in the air or somewhere without a good connection?!

Or is that something that should be done through my IE rather than a PH thing to download?

Just a thought from a bored traveller...

Way back in the day of dial up connections and time limits and all that, I used to click on all the threads that looked interesting and then save them for reading at a later offline date so I didn't blow my limited internet time reading. I think IE saves all the images and stuff associated with the page so it's not too bad. You do have to save each page of each thread individually though, which can be a bit of a drag for nonsense threads.

There are some programs that help automate it, but they tend to grap all kinds of crap you dont need as well, I usually found the manual method quicker and more efficient anyway.

There are plenty of ways to do it yourself. Tools are available that will download all pages that a given page links to, then all the pages those pages link to, etc. You can choose how far they will go. Should get up to, say, the 3rd page of any forum (or all forums if you wanted).

Could be worth a try.
